The clash between Gutfeld and Tarlov occurred during a segment on "The Five." Gutfeld’s initial assertion that political violence stems primarily from the left prompted Tarlov to introduce the case of Melissa Hortman, a Democratic state representative who, along with her husband, was murdered earlier this year.
Gutfeld’s dismissive reaction to Hortman’s case, questioning why it didn’t receive similar attention, sparked a heated response from Tarlov. Gutfeld argued that there was no prior "demonization" of Hortman, implying the cases were not comparable. He further stated that the “both sides” argument is invalid, reflecting a broader sentiment among some conservatives.
Subsequent reports indicated that the suspect in the Hortman assassination had a list of potential targets, suggesting a political motive. This detail contradicts Gutfeld’s claim that the crime was merely a "specific crime against her by somebody who knew her."
